Output 64e6000e12de4d5c5d284a66416271a63d4e820a45aa5871d55931fd25aab43a:0

value
9055267
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db5d9abf7eb96f461d743521a41024bc659d7b87 OP_EQUALVERIFY OP_CHECKSIG
address
1Lzu7mLek8unCbATtNR3dr1L6hZztVr2Jk
transaction
64e6000e12de4d5c5d284a66416271a63d4e820a45aa5871d55931fd25aab43a
confirmations
330911
spent
true